Man (MANINDS.NS) stock analysis | technical momentum and analyst sentiment remain in focus. Man Industries (India) Limited (NSE: MANINDS.NS) closed at ₹509.75 on the latest session, registering a decline of 3.57% from its previous close. The stock is now trading closer to its near-term support of ₹484.26, while resistance remains at ₹535.24. The move lower comes amid broader selling pressure and could test key technical levels in the coming sessions.
